技术文摘
如何查看 SQL 数据库错误
如何查看SQL数据库错误
在数据库管理与开发过程中,快速准确地查看SQL数据库错误至关重要。它有助于及时定位问题、修复故障,确保数据库系统的稳定运行。
日志文件是查看SQL数据库错误的重要途径。不同的数据库管理系统都有相应的日志记录机制。以常见的MySQL为例,通过查看错误日志文件,能获取详细的错误信息。在MySQL配置文件中,可以找到错误日志的路径,通常为log - error参数指定的位置。日志文件会记录数据库启动、运行过程中遇到的各种错误,如连接失败、语法错误等。而对于SQL Server,也有类似的错误日志,可在SQL Server Management Studio中轻松访问。通过日志,管理员能快速了解系统的运行状况,发现潜在问题。
数据库管理系统提供的错误代码与错误消息也能辅助我们查找错误。当执行SQL语句出现错误时,系统会返回相应的错误代码和简短的错误消息。这些代码和消息是定位问题的关键线索。例如,在Oracle数据库中,如果出现“ORA - 00942: table or view does not exist”错误代码和消息,就表明引用的表或视图不存在。开发人员和管理员可以根据错误代码在官方文档中查找详细的解释和解决方案,大大节省了排查问题的时间。
数据库客户端工具在查看错误方面也发挥着重要作用。许多图形化客户端工具,如Navicat、Toad等,在执行SQL语句出错时,会直观地显示错误信息。这些工具不仅能展示错误消息,还能提供一些额外的上下文信息,帮助用户更好地理解错误产生的原因。例如,它可能会指出错误发生在SQL语句的哪一行,让用户快速定位问题代码段。
掌握查看SQL数据库错误的方法,能让数据库管理员和开发人员在面对问题时迅速做出反应,减少系统故障时间,保障数据库系统高效、稳定地运行。
- 10 个优质网络监视工具推荐
- 从零手写 RPC 框架:鲜为人知的技术
- 这 5 个 Python 特性,早知多好
- Office 365 Online 安全连接之道
- 中台是架构的捷径吗
- 腾讯大佬分享:写 Python 选用何种 IDE 为宜
- React、Angular 与 Vue.js:究竟如何抉择?
- 搜狗地图推出手机 AR 实景高精导航:具备实时车距计算与碰撞预警功能
- 数据科学工作必备技能有哪些?
- 微软推出新工具打击网上对儿童侵害 获网友点赞
- 新年首个 Bug 太扎心!
- 开发者的十种常见不良编程习性
- TCP 四次挥手:熟知之后,意外、攻击与单端跑路情况如何?
- Vim 退出之难众人愁!硬核程序员传授花式技巧,一周获 2400 星
- Hystrix 资源隔离的两把利器